Where your figures actually go
Your answers live in the address bar. That is the whole storage mechanism: the link is the saved calculation, which is why it restores every answer and works on somebody else’s machine.
This has a consequence worth stating plainly rather than burying. A web address is sent to the server that serves the page, and servers keep access logs. So the figures in a calculator link may appear in the hosting provider’s logs — the same way any URL you visit does.
The PDF statement is different, and deliberately so. Its inputs travel in
the part of the address after the #, which browsers never send to
a server at all. A statement is assembled entirely inside your browser.

Which privacy law applies
Australia’s Privacy Act 1988 exempts most businesses turning over $3 million or less a year, and this site is well under that. It is written to meet the Australian Privacy Principles anyway — the exemption is about obligation, not about whether you deserve to be told what happens to your information.
Third parties
None on the page. No advertising, no tracking pixels, no embedded widgets. Fonts and animation libraries are served from this site’s own origin rather than a content delivery network, so loading a page does not tell anyone else that you did.
